IFNI. La mili africana dels catalans

Author/s
Alberto López Bargados, Eloy Martín Corrales and Khalid El-Mansouri

A book that explains, in black and white, the vicissitudes experienced by Catalan soldiers in the Spanish colony of Ifni during Francoism. Ifni was the translation of Franco’s imperialist dreams into practice. And the cause – in 1957 and 1958 – of a war that his regime concealed as well as they could.

 Nonetheless, to oblige those imperialist desires, many Catalan soldiers found themselves involved in a senseless occupation and war. This book recovers the memory of those times and, in particular, the experiences of so many Catalans who were the involuntary protagonists of the period.
